Cis- \Cis-\
A Latin preposition, sometimes used as a prefix in English
words, and signifying on this side.

CIS
n : an alliance made up of states that had been Soviet Socialist
Republics in the Soviet Union prior to its dissolution in
Dec 1991 [syn: {Commonwealth of Independent States}]
